          Integration Procedure for an Auto Insurance Product Rating

          Integration Procedure for an Auto Insurance Product Rating

          The product model underpins all the business processes used in a line of business. Services that price insurance products pull data from the product model, perform rating procedure calculations using that data, and then insert coverage and premium prices into the product model.

          Here's an example of a product model for a Multi Auto root product at a high level:

          Illustrates the high-level product model for the Multi Auto root product.

          To rate the Multi Auto insurance product, we use this Integration procedure:

          • Type: Auto

          • Subtype: MultiInstanceRating

          • Name: Auto+MultiDriver Rating

          Here's what this Integration Procedure does at a high level:

          Diagram of workflow for an Integration Procedure that rates an insurance product

          The Integration Procedure orchestrates the two major rating calculations: the driver calculations and then the vehicle calculations.

          Here's what the Auto MultiInstanceRating Integration Procedure looks like:

          Integration Procedure with Procedure Configuration properties highlighted

          Before you create your own Integration Procedure to rate your auto insurance products, review and test the structure of this one to see how it works. You can model your own Integration Procedure on this one if it works for you.

          Here's what component each step of the procedure uses, and what each step does:

          1. Expression Set Action

            Rates the drivers by calling the autoRateDrivers expression set.

            The following remote options are set:

            • Key: includeInputKeys

              Value: autoVehicle.instanceKey,autoDriver.instanceKey

              What it does: Specifies the keys to include from the input set into the output sets of the calculation results. The aggByKey option and subsequent steps of this Integration Procedure use these keys to identify the correct set of calculation results.

            • Key: includeInputs

              Value: true

              What it does: Turns on the code that pulls the instance keys specified by the includeInputKeys option.

            • Key: aggByKey

              Value: autoVehicle.instanceKey

              What it does: Uses the autoVehicle.instance key InputKey in the calculation result sets to determine the sets to run aggregation steps on.

            • Key: effectiveDate

              Value: %options:effectiveDate%

              What it does: Passes in this value as an option to the InsProductService: getRatedProduct service used by this Integration Procedure. This data is used to pull the correct versions of expression sets and lookup tables for the Integration Procedure to use.

          2. List Action

            Merges the calculation results (rateDrivers:output:aggregationResults) for drivers from step 1 with the original input data (input_1) from the input JSON. Matches the autoVehicle.instanceKey from the driver calculation output and merges the data.

          3. Expression Set Action

            Rates the vehicles by calling the autoRateVehicles expression set.

            • Key: includeInputKeys

              Value: autoVehicle.instanceKey,productKey,parentProdKey

              What it does: Specifies the keys to include from the input set into the output sets of the calculation results.

            • Key: includeInputs

              Value: true

              What it does: Turns on the code that pulls the instance keys specified by the includeInputKeys option.

            • Key: includeRawCalculationResult

              Value: true

              What it does: Appends the raw calculation results from this expression set to the output JSON (as well as the parsed calculation results).

            • Key: effectiveDate

              Value: %options:effectiveDate%

              What it does: Passes in this value as an option to the InsProductService:getRatedProduct service used by this Integration Procedure. This data is used to pull the correct versions of expression sets and lookup tables for the Integration Procedure to use.

          4. Response Action

            Returns the response for the Expression Set Action in step 4. The Send JSON Path specified is standard, sending only the necessary nodes.
